1、extend():在列表末尾一次性添加另一个序列中的多个值
a=[1,2,3]
b=[4,5,6]
a.extend(b)
a
输出:[1, 2, 3, 4, 5, 6]
2、append():在列表末尾添加单个值
a=[1,2,3]
a.append(4)
a
输出:[1, 2, 3, 4]
a=[1,2,3]
a.append([9,0])
a
输出:[1, 2, 3, [9, 0]]
a=[1,2,3]
a.append('hello')
a
输出:[1, 2, 3, ‘hello’]
注意!extend()和append()函数都没有返回值,都是在原列表中就地新增!所以new=a.extend(b)
这种写法是不会返回extend后的列表的,只会返回一个None值。